Paris Fashion Week: Limi Feu's Matrimonial Spring 2011 Collection

Some may believe an entire black and white collection constitutes a safe collection, but designer Limi Feu proves it will always be cutting edge in her spring 2011 runway show.

Aside from her untraditional color palette, there were a couple of interesting occurrences. Midway through the show, pregnant model Sachi Kawamata marched down the runway in a tea-length, black cotton dress. She was followed by a pair of models walking side-by-side, clad in matching top hats, and portraying a matrimonial vision. Although Feu's collection is not for every couple - the androgynous womenswear included distressed dresses, Doc Martens, and ironic pairings of different silhouettes. Highlights from the menswear were suspenders and wide-leg and tailored pants, most of which seemed unpractical but fashion-forward. Just in case you weren't buying into the emphasis on matrimony, the final looks to hit the runway were undeniably bridal inspired sans the bouquet.

Who will be the next couple spotted in Limi Feu?
